The 2025 Iu Mien - Yao Music Festival is on in Chiang Saen.
The dates: 17-18 April 2025.
Note this is not the annual Iu Mien Festival that has featured on GTR here.

Iu Mien Cultural Festival
The “Iu Mien Cultural Festival” was conceived several years ago and finally born in April 2017 at the Mekong Giant Catfish Pier in Chiang Khong District, Chiang Rai Province. The festival was nurtured by its creators, along with family members and neighbors, growing into a beloved event. This joy extended to relatives in other provinces and even spread to those living abroad.
In its early years, up to the age of three, the creators and the community in Chiang Rai made significant efforts, through trial and error, to ensure the festival developed robustly.
Recognising the challenges faced by the Chiang Rai community, relatives in Nan Province took over the festival’s care.
Despite the deep affection from Chiang Rai, they entrusted the festival to their kin in Nan to ensure its continued growth.
During its time in Nan, the festival thrived, receiving warm hospitality and care. It became well-known among the Iu Mien community both in Thailand and abroad. Its unique charm attracted various government agencies, which began to support and promote its further development.
After three years in Nan, the festival’s reputation had grown significantly. The community in Phayao Province expressed a desire to host it. Thus, after its tenure in Nan, the festival moved to Phayao for a year. At eight years old, the festival was vibrant and lively, leading to occasional disagreements among its caretakers, perhaps due to its increasing popularity.
Ultimately, the community in Nan retrieved the festival, acknowledging that it had been away from its birthplace for four years. The creators in Chiang Rai, missing the festival dearly, wished for its return. Despite their deep affection, the Nan community agreed to send the festival back to its origins.
Upon its return to Chiang Rai, a warm welcome was organized, with relatives from various provinces and abroad joining in the celebration. Representatives from Nan attended in large numbers to congratulate the Chiang Rai community.
The recent event was heartwarming, bringing tears to many. We deeply appreciate and commend the Chiang Rai community for their dedication in organizing such a grand and warm reception for the “Iu Mien Cultural Festival.”
The festival’s charm has even attracted Iu Mien relatives from abroad, who wish to host it for a year, with preparations already underway.
